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a specific locksmith who concentrates on automotive locks and keys. They are equipped to deal with a large range of problems, from easy key duplications to complicated elect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mith professionals, in specific, are experts who can pertain to your place,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the roadway, to provide instant support.
Providers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Duplication
- Standard Keys: If you require an additional key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can rapidly duplicate your existing key.
- Remote Keys: For cars with keyless entry systems, car locksmith professionals can program and replicate remote keys, ensuring you can open and start your car without concerns.
Lockout Assistance
- ** opening Doors **: If you've locked your type in the car, a mobile car locksmith can securely unlock your vehicle without triggering dam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
- Ignition Lockout: For scenarios where you can't begin your car since the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can help extract it.
Key Replacement
-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key, a locksmith can develop a new one ut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.
- Broken Keys: If your key is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and make sure the brand-new key works effortlessly with your car.
Transponder Key Programming
- New Keys: Many contemporary vehicles featured transponder keys, which require programming to the car's onboard computer. A professional car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to ensure it operates properly.
- Reprogramming: If your transponder key has stopped working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its functionality.
Lock Installation and Repair
- New Locks: If your car's locks are broken or harmed, a car locksmith can set up new, top quality locks.
- Lock Repair: For small issues like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to guarantee smooth operation.
Security Upgrades
- High-Security Locks: For included assurance, a car locksmith can set up high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.
- Immobilizer Systems: These innovative security systems prevent your car from starting if the appropriate key is not present. A car locksmith can install and program immobilizer systems.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Locksmith Services
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ith assistance if I lock my type in the car?
- A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can securely unlock your car without triggering any damage. They are geared up with tools and strategies to handle various lockout scenarios.
Q2: How much does it cost to get a new car key made?
- A2: The expense can vary depending upon the kind of key and the intricacy of the vehicle's lock system. Requirement ke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.
Q3: Can a locksmith program a new transponder key?
- A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a new transponder key locksmith car to your vehicle's onboard computer system. This is a typical service for modern lorries that require this kind of key.
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
- A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to force it out. Instead, call a mobile car locksmith who can securely extract the broken key and supply a replacement if necessary.
Q5: How can I avoid being locked out of my car?
- A5: Keep a spare type in a safe place, such as a trusted friend's home or a safe key box. Routinely examine your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by an expert locksmith.
Q6: Are mobile car locksmith professionals trusted?
- A6: Yes, mobile car locksmith professionals are usually reputable. Try to find experts with excellent evaluations, appropriate licensing, and a performance history of pleased consumers.
Tips for Maintaining Your Car Locks and Keys
Routine Lubrication
- Use a silicone-based lubricant to keep your locks and keys moving smoothly. This can prevent wear and tear and reduce the risk of lockouts.
Prevent Excessive Force
- When inserting or turning your key, avoid using extreme force. This can damage the lock or key and cause more major concerns.
Keep Your Keys Safe
- Store your car type in a safe and accessible location. Prevent putting them near windows or in areas where they can be quickly stolen.
Examine Locks Regularly
- Frequently inspect your car locks for any signs of wear, rust, or damage. If you see any concerns, have them examined and fixed by a professional locksmith.
Think About Keyless Entry Systems
- If your vehicle supports it, consider updating to a keyless entry system. These systems can reduce the threat of lockouts and provide extra security.
